I have been using CAF for over 50 years as I do not like being tied to a particular charity in case there is an emergency appeal from one of the several charities that I support and I want to make a donation to that appeal that is 'out of step' from my usual pattern of giving.
Never had any security or other issues with the CAF website.
Website is easy to use, management of funds and donations is fairly clear EXCEPT when more than 1 donation is made within a logged-on session. For some reason the 'funds remaining' message correctly subtracts the first donation to provide an updated total. However, if a second donation is made within the same session the total is NOT updated to indicate the remaining funds: it is frozen as if no second donation has been made. If you want to give a third donation then it creates a situation where you think that you have more funds remaining than you actually have unless you keep your own manual running total!
